The replacement codes are "The God" cheats in Zelda: Twilight Princess. What you can do with such cheats is spawning enemies, objects and other stuff mostly already feactured into the game somewhere else on a location where a spawn point is set, like an Ordon Sign from the Ordon Village. If the value for example is 211, which is a Darknut, the Ordon signs in the Ordon Village will be replaced by the value of the code, which is the Darknut (211).
